Table 4.
Differentially expressed genes in CD8+ T cell subsets
| Gene ID | Gene name | Fold change |
Function/gene ontology |
|---|---|---|---|
| (a) Microarray analyses of downregulated CD8+ T cell genes from pCons-tolerized vs naive mice | |||
| Igl-V1 | Immunoglobulin lambda chain (IgL)a | −8.0 | Endogenous antigen binding and processing/MHC class I receptor activity/immune response |
| - | IgG light chain gene, V region | −6.1 | Antigen binding/immune response |
| - | RIKEN full-length enriched library, clone:A430018E01 | −5.7 | Unknown |
| Pde4b | Phosphodiesterase 4B | −5.3 | cAMP-specific phosphodiesterase activity/regulation of PKA signal transduction |
| Pde7a | Phosphodiesterase 7A | −5.3 | cAMP-specific phosphodiesterase activity/regulation of PKA signal transduction |
| Lasp1 | LIM and SH3 protein 1 | −4.6 | Actin binding/cytoskeletal organization/focal adhesion-mediated signal transduction |
| Pabpc1 | Poly A-binding protein, cytoplasmic 1 | −4.0 | RNA binding/RNA stability/translation |
| Smc4l1 | SMC4 structural maintenance of chromosomes 4-like 1 | −3.7 | ATPase activity/mitosis/sister chromatid exchange |
| Igh-VJ558 | Immunoglobulin heavy chain (J558 family) | −3.5 | Antigen binding/immune response |
| Capza1 | Capping protein (actin filament) muscle Z-line, α-1 | −3.0 | Barbed-end actin filament capping/negative regulation of actin filament depolymerization |
| Dnaja2 | DnaJ (Hsp40) homolog, subfamily A, member 2 | −2.8 | HSP70 co-chaperone/protein folding/protein transport |
| - | ESTs | −2.8 | Unknown |
| Mcl1 | Myeloid cell leukemia sequence 1 | −2.8 | Regulation of programmed cell death |
| Sesn3 | Sestrin 3 | −2.5 | Negative regulation of cell cycle progression |
| Arid4b | AT-rich interactive domain 4B (Rbp1 like) | −2.5 | Possible involvement in repression of transcription or RNA processing/splicing |
| Igtp | Interferon-inducible GTPase 2 | −2.5 | GTPase activity/Response to pest, pathogen or parasite |
| - | Mus musculus expressed sequence AI893585 | −2.3 | Unknown |
| Utrn | Utrophin | −2.3 | Cytoskeletal binding/calcium ion binding/muscle contraction/chemotaxis |
| Igl-V1 | IgL variable regiona | −2.3 | Endogenous antigen binding and processing/MHC class I receptor activity/immune response |
| Igh-VJ558 | Immunoglobulin heavy chain (J558 family) | −1.5 | Antigen binding/immune response |
| (b) Microarray analyses of upregulated CD8+ T cell genes from pCons-tolerized vs naive mice | |||
| S100a8 | S100 calcium-binding protein A8 (calgranulin A) | 3.2 | Calcium ion binding/chemotaxis/cellular locomotion/inflammation |
| H2-K1 | MHC class I heavy chain precursor (H-2K(d)) | 3.2 | Antigen binding and processing/MHC class I protein complex/immune response |
| Gypa | Glycophorin A | 3.2 | Cell adhesion molecule/cytoskeletal anchoring/response to osmotic stress |
| Prdx2 | Peroxiredoxin 2 | 2.8 | Thioredoxin peroxidase activity/response to oxidative stress/anti-apoptosis |
| S100a9 | S100 calcium-binding protein A9 (calgranulin B) | 2.8 | Calcium ion binding/chemotaxis/cellular locomotion/inflammation |
| Rsad2 | Viperin (Vig1)a | 2.6 | Interferon-inducible anti-viral activity |
| Alas2 | Aminolevulinic acid synthase 2 | 2.6 | N-succinyltransferase activity/porphyrin, heme biosynthesis |
| Cd24a | CD24a antigena | 2.5 | Cell surface antigen/regulation of T-cell expansion |
| 5730469M10Rik | RIKEN cDNA 5730469M10 gene | 2.5 | Unknown |
| Eraf | Erythroid-associated factor | 2.5 | Hemoglobin binding/hemopoiesis |
| Car2 | Carbonic anhydrase 2 | 2.3 | carbon-oxygen lyase activity/interconverts carbon dioxide and carbonic acid/respiration |
| 1110063G11Rik | MKIAA0481 proteina | 2.3 | Integral membrane protein |
| Hba-a1 | Hemoglobin-α, adult chain 1a | 2.1 | heme, iron, oxygen binding/oxygen transport |
| Slc4a1 | Solute carrier family 4 (anion exchanger), member 1 | 2.1 | Inorganic anion transport/intrinsic to plasma membrane |
| Mscp | Solute carrier family 25, member 37 (Slc25a37), variant 1 | 1.9 | Ion and metabolite exchange/mitochondrial transport |
| Alad | Aminolevulinate, delta-, dehydratase | 1.7 | Carbon-oxygen lyase activity/porphyrin, heme biosynthesis |
| Klf1 | Kruppel-like factor 1 | 1.7 | DNA binding/regulation of transcription/chromatin remodeling |
| Hbb-b1 | Hemoglobin, β-adult major chain | 1.6 | Heme, iron, oxygen binding/oxygen transport/respiration |
| Bpgm | 2,3-bisphosphoglycerate mutase | 1.4 | Bisphosphoglycerate phosphatase activity/glucose metabolism |
Differentially expressed genes in tolerized vs naive BWF1 CD8+T cells were obtained after microarray analyses. Fluorescence intensity and signal to log ratios were obtained as described in the Materials and methods section, and fold changes and P-values were determined.
Replicate probe sets.
